Die kleinste vierstellige Zahl ist 1000. Dividiere 1000 durch 210: - alerta
Dividing 1000 by 210 means figuring out how many times 210 fits into 1000âand what remains after the largest full count. Since 210 Ă 4 = 840, and 210 Ă 5 = 1050, 210 fits four times cleanly into 1000, leaving a fractional remainderâabout 160. This teaches how division breaks numbers into whole portions and leftover fractionsâa foundational concept in arithmetic and everyday estimation.
